    On October 30, news came from Liyang County that Fugong E, who served as the prefect of Liyang County, killed Liu Guo, the county prime minister, and proclaimed himself emperor in rebellion.

    As Du Fuwei's close friend, Fugong Er was also a brother-like figure at the beginning.  In order to save Du Fuwei, Fugong Er could steal his aunt's sheep. Du Fuwei also called Fugong Er his brother.

    But in this world, there are some people who can share adversity but not wealth.

    As Du Fuwei became stronger and stronger, some gaps arose between the two in terms of military power.  This did not affect the relationship between the two, until Du Fuwei accidentally learned that Huang Mingyuan was his adoptive father and decided to raise his troops to surrender to the Sui Dynasty.

    Duke Fu was unwilling to surrender to the Sui Dynasty.

    Du and Fu had differences over this and broke up unhappy.  Fu Gonger chose to reserve his opinion and return to Liyang. In order to prevent a recurrence of things, Du Fuwei deprived Fu Gonger of his military power and only appointed him to be in charge of civil affairs.

    On the surface, the differences between the two have been resolved, but the issue of route has always been a matter of life and death. It is not easy to reconcile.

    After Du Fuwei led his troops to surrender, Fugong Er was appointed as the prefect of Liyang County and stationed in Du Fuwei's hometown.  It seems that he has a lot of power, but Huang Weiyang arranged for him to have Liu Guosuke, the county magistrate.

    Liu Guo was from Hebei and had joined the Sui army since the Liaodong period. He had served as county magistrate and county magistrate in Liaodong. Later, he was selected as Huang Weiyang's staff and served as a civil servant to join the army.  After returning to Jiangdu, Huang Weiyang appointed Liu Guo as the Prime Minister of Liyang County, mainly hoping that he would implement the land and taxation reforms of the Sui Dynasty in Liyang County.  Therefore, although Liu Guo is the county magistrate, his actual power is no less than that of the prefect.

    When Liu Guo arrived in Liyang, he carried out drastic reforms according to the Liaodong model.

    His methods are too rough and his attitude is too radical.  For local wealthy families who do not carry out rectification, they will be severely punished.

    Even the old troops of Du Fuwei's army showed no mercy.

    Because of the suppression of the Sui army, although there were occasional turbulence in the local area, it did not have much impact.  As for Fu Gong'er, although he was the governor, the reform team led by Liu Guo seized all the power, so the two sides had a direct conflict because of their power.  Regarding the conflict between the two, Xingtai fully supports Liu Guo.  Fugong Er had no choice but to pretend to learn Taoism and the art of fasting with his old acquaintance Zuo Youxian to cover it up, but he was full of dissatisfaction in his heart.

    During this period, Fu Gonger wrote several letters to criticize Du Fuwei and expressed his dissatisfaction with Liu Guo. Unfortunately, Du Fuwei was in the army and did not understand local affairs. He only thought that Fu Gonger was dissatisfied with the surrender, so he wrote harshly.  He scolded the other party severely several times.

    Fu Gong'er secretly resented Du Fuwei's ruthlessness and became even more dissatisfied.

    Liu Guo vigorously carried out reforms in Liyang County, surveyed the land, collected commercial taxes, and counted hidden households, which naturally caused dissatisfaction among the local aristocratic families, and Fugong E secretly got in touch with this group of people.

    Or rather, the aristocratic family tried every means to connect with Fugong Er.

    However, the Sui army was stationed at that time.  There were heavy troops in Jiangdu, Jiangning, Dangtu, Hefei, and Xuancheng around Liyang, and Fu Gong'er did not dare to act rashly.

    But after the Battle of Huaining, Huang Weiyang led the main force of the expedition southward and did not return for several months, so Fugong Er had something to think about.

    Liyang County Lieutenant Ximen Junyi is also an old man in the Du Fuwei Group. When Du Fuwei was defeated, his wife Wang Peng picked up Du Fuwei and ran away, saving Du Fuwei's life. Therefore, Ximen Junyi  Du Fu has great prestige.

    Originally, Ximen Junyi supported Du Fuwei¡¯s surrender, but after all??As a bandit, everyone wants to clear their name.  However, after the surrender, Du Fuwei's tribe did not gain much benefit. A county lieutenant alone could not meet Ximen Junyi's requirements.  Not only was his official position low, he was also bound by Sui law.

    Everyone rebelled because they wanted money and official positions, but the Sui Dynasty could not satisfy them with either of these things, so how could they not make them resentful.

    With everyone¡¯s dissatisfaction and Liu Guo¡¯s mishandling, Du Fuwei¡¯s old men gradually began to fall into chaos.

    People are like this. When in trouble, they usually stick together, so Fu Gong'er, the second in command of Du Fuwei's forces, quickly united Du Fuwei's old troops in Liyang.

    At the same time, Huang Weiyang also made a mistake.

    During the general reorganization of the army, each department cleared some of its redundant soldiers.  These people were not simply laid off, but were placed in various counties and given fields for farming.

    ? Among them, because Du Fuwei had a large number of people, and most of them were bandits, their combat effectiveness and discipline were relatively weak, so a large number of them were eliminated.

    This is what should be done, but the problem is that Huang Weiyang is worried that too many of Du Fuwei's troops will be eliminated at one time, which will easily cause dissatisfaction among his soldiers, so he did not disperse these people and deal with them, but relocated them all to Liyang.  County.

    This group of people are used to being bandits. They enjoy killing people and stealing goods. Who would dig in the dirt for food?  Many people are not willing to just arrange for them to farm.

    So with the help of Fu Gong'er and Ximen Junyi, many people were immediately gathered together.

    Liu Guo, the county magistrate, was capable and passionate, but he was accustomed to the strong power of the Sui Dynasty in Liaodong, and he lacked any vigilance and sense of crisis for local changes.  So under his nose, a turmoil slowly took shape, but Liu Guo watched helplessly and did not notice it.

    At the same time, Fugong Er secretly united with many aristocratic families in Huainan and Jiangnan.

    Control the big one and control the owl.  Huang Weiyang's radical policy harmed not only the interests of Fugong Er and his group, but also the aristocratic families in the Jianghuai region.  For example, setting up a farm and collecting business taxes are all cutting off the flesh of a wealthy family.

    In this way, Fugong Er and the Jianghuai family gradually colluded to form an interest group that opposed the Sui Dynasty and was ready to explode at any time.

    Huang Weiyang fought in Yuzhang for a long time without returning, and Fugong Er finally made up his mind to launch a rebellion
